U.N. Commissioner for Eritera Consults Jewish Leaders

September 7, 1951
See Original Daily Bulletin From This Date

The United Nations High Commissioner in Eritrea has completed his consultations with representatives of various organizations in connection with the drafting of a constitution for Eritrea, it was reported here today by the U.N. headquarters. Among other groups, the Commissioner, Dr. Eduardo Anze Matienzo, received leaders of the Eritrea Jewish Community who expressed the hope that a legal basis for the protection of minorities and the rights of foreigners would be provided for in the constitution.
